1. Streamline Communication Processes

Sales email management solutions provide a centralized platform for managing all your email communications. By consolidating all your sales emails in one place, you can easily track and organize conversations with prospects and customers. This streamlines communication processes, ensuring that no important emails slip through the cracks and enabling you to respond promptly to inquiries and requests.

2. Enhance Productivity and Efficiency

Manually managing sales emails can be time-consuming, leading to decreased productivity and missed opportunities. Sales email management solutions automate various tasks, such as email tracking, follow-ups, and scheduling, freeing up valuable time for sales professionals to focus on more critical activities, such as building relationships and closing deals. With features like templates and personalized email campaigns, these solutions also enable sales teams to send targeted and consistent messages, further enhancing efficiency.

3. Improve Sales Performance

Effective email management can significantly impact sales performance. Sales email management solutions provide analytics and insights into email engagement, allowing you to track open rates, click-through rates, and responses. By analyzing this data, you can identify the most effective email templates, subject lines, and content, enabling you to optimize your sales emails for better engagement and conversions. This, in turn, leads to improved sales performance and increased revenue.

4. Enhance Collaboration and Team Alignment

In sales, collaboration and team alignment are crucial for success. Sales email management solutions facilitate collaboration among team members by allowing them to access and share email conversations, ensuring everyone is on the same page. It eliminates the need for forwarding or CCing emails, reducing confusion and miscommunication. With features like email assignment and tracking, these solutions also enable managers to monitor team performance, provide feedback, and ensure accountability.

5. Maintain Professionalism and Brand Consistency

Consistency in communication is vital for maintaining professionalism and building a strong brand image. Sales email management solutions provide tools for creating and managing email templates, ensuring that your team delivers consistent and on-brand messages. This consistency helps to establish trust with prospects and customers, enhancing your overall sales effectiveness.

1. Identifying Your Business Needs

Before diving into the sea of options, it's essential to identify and prioritize your specific business needs. Consider the size of your sales team, the volume of emails you handle, the level of automation required, and any specific features or integrations you require. Assessing your needs will help you narrow down the options and choose a solution that aligns with your requirements.

2. Comparing Different Email Management Tools

Once you have a clear understanding of your business needs, it's time to research and compare different sales email management tools available in the market. Consider factors such as ease of use, scalability, integration capabilities, analytics and reporting features, customization options, and customer support. Look for solutions that have positive user reviews and a track record of reliability and security.

3. Setting up a Budget for Email Management Solution

As with any business investment, it's important to set up a budget for implementing a sales email management solution. Consider the costs associated with acquiring the software or platform, any additional hardware or infrastructure requirements, ongoing subscription or licensing fees, and potential training or implementation costs. It's also important to factor in the potential return on investment (ROI) that the solution can bring to your sales team.

4. Evaluating Security and Data Privacy

Sales emails often contain sensitive customer information, making security and data privacy crucial considerations when choosing a sales email management solution. Ensure that the solution you choose complies with relevant data protection regulations and provides robust security features, such as encryption, user access controls, and secure data storage. Look for certifications or audits that validate the solution's commitment to data security.

5. Seeking Recommendations and Demoing Solutions

To gain more insights into the effectiveness and usability of different sales email management solutions, seek recommendations from industry peers or colleagues who have had experience with such tools. Additionally, consider requesting demos or trials from shortlisted solutions to get a hands-on experience and assess how well they meet your specific requirements. This will help you make an informed decision based on firsthand experience.

1. Implementing Best Practices

To optimize the use of your sales email management solution, it's important to implement best practices that align with your sales processes and goals. Consider the following practices:

- Personalize your emails: Craft personalized and targeted emails that resonate with your recipients. Use the recipient's name, refer to their specific needs or pain points, and tailor your messaging to address their unique situation.

- Use email templates: Utilize pre-designed email templates provided by your sales email management solution. Templates can save time, ensure consistency, and help you deliver professional and effective emails to your prospects and customers.

- Leverage email automation: Take advantage of automation features offered by your sales email management solution. Automate follow-up emails, nurture sequences, and other repetitive tasks to save time and ensure timely communication with your leads and customers.

- Optimize subject lines: Write compelling subject lines that grab attention and encourage recipients to open your emails. Experiment with different subject line strategies, such as using personalization, creating a sense of urgency, or asking intriguing questions.

- A/B test your emails: Test different variations of your emails to identify the most effective elements, such as subject lines, email copy, call-to-action buttons, or visuals. A/B testing can help you optimize your email content for higher open and response rates.

1. Tracking Key Performance Indicators (KPIs)

To measure the effectiveness of your sales email management solution, it's important to track relevant KPIs. Consider the following KPIs:

- Open rates: Measure the percentage of recipients who open your sales emails. This indicates the effectiveness of your subject lines and email content in capturing the attention of your audience.

- Click-through rates: Track the percentage of recipients who click on links or calls-to-action within your emails. This measures the engagement and interest generated by your email content.

- Response rates: Monitor the percentage of recipients who respond to your sales emails. This indicates the effectiveness of your messaging and the level of engagement with your audience.

- Conversion rates: Measure the percentage of recipients who take the desired action, such as making a purchase or scheduling a meeting, as a result of your sales emails. This reflects the overall impact of your email communication on driving sales and achieving your goals.

Regularly analyze these KPIs using the analytics and reporting features provided by your sales email management solution. Compare the performance of different email campaigns, templates, and strategies to identify areas of success and areas that need improvement.
